ZONING BOARD OF APPEALS AGENDA
October 24, 2023 (7pm)


Hearings

Maximo and Karen Buschfrers, 174 15th Avenue, Sea Cliff, New York, to construct a detached garage, which construction requires variances of the following Village Code sections: (a) 138-416(A) to permit the garage in a front yard, where no accessory structure is permitted, (b) 138-416(E) to permit a height of 20 feet, where a maximum height of 15 feet is permitted, and (c) 138-1001, to permit a curb cut within 25 feet of an intersection, where no such curb cut is permitted.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block F, Lot 729 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.


John Cilia, 16 The Boulevard, Sea Cliff, New York, to (a) maintain an existing second floor addition, which maintenance requires variances of the following Village of Sea Cliff Village Code sections: (i) 138-511, to permit a side yard setback of 3.95 feet, where a minimum of 15 feet is required, (ii) 138-513.1, to permit an encroachment into the height setback area, where no such encroachment is permitted, and (iii) 138-514.1, to permit a floor area of 2,459 square feet, where a maximum of 1,824 square feet is permitted, and (b) to install an air conditioner condensing unit 3.13 feet from the side property line, where Village Code §138-516 requires a minimum setback of 15 feet.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block A, Lot 31 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.


68 Glenlawn LLC, 68 Glenlawn Avenue, Sea Cliff, New York, to obtain a certificate of occupancy for two (2) existing dwelling units and construct a second story dormer on the eastern dwelling structure, which requires variances of the following Village of Sea Cliff Village Code sections: (a) 138-501, to permit two (2) dwelling units, where such use is not permitted, (b) 138-506, to permit a street frontage of  84.83 feet, where a minimum of 100 feet is required, (c) 138-511, to permit an side yard setbacks of 11.6 and 2.5 feet, where a minimum of 15 feet is required, (d) 138-512, to permit a rear yard setback of 6.8 feet, where a minimum of 30 feet is required, (e) 138-513.1, to permit both dwelling structures to encroach into the height setback ratio, where no such encroachment is permitted, and (f)  138-514, to permit a dwelling unit with a 400 square foot first floor and total floor area of 800 square feet, where the required minimum first floor is 650 square feet and the required minimum total floor area is 1,000 square feet.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block 188, Lot 22 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.


Jessica and Joseph Bonvicino, 395 Littleworth Lane, Sea Cliff, New York, to construct a second story addition, which requires a variance of Village Code §138-614.1, to permit a floor area ratio of 23.8%, where a maximum of 23% is permitted.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block M, Lot 578 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.
160 15th Avenue LLC, 160 15th Avenue, Sea Cliff, New York, for variances to construct a 24.83 feet high garage in a front yard, where Village Code §138-416 permits a maximum height of 15 feet and prohibits a garage from being located in a front yard.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block F, Lot 727 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.
Barry and Tobi LeBron, 28 Main Avenue, Sea Cliff, New York, to construct a 3rd floor dormer, which construction requires variances of the following Village Code sections: (a) 138-408, to permit a front yard setback of 15.12 feet, where a minimum of 15 feet is required, and (b) 138-413.1, to permit an encroachment into the height setback ratio, where no such encroachment is permitted.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block F, Lot 729 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.


[Continued hearing] Pezzi Pizza, Inc., 500 Glen Cove Avenue, Sea Cliff, New York, to construct additions, which additions require variances of the following Village Code sections: (a) 138-913, to permit the staircase enclosure to be 15.1 feet from the rear property line, where  a minimum of 20 feet is required; (b) 138-917, to permit a 3 foot buffer area, where a 20 foot buffer area is required; (c) 138-1002, to provide for no additional parking, where 5 additional parking spaces are required; and (d) 138-1102, to permit a building to be altered in a manner that will result in an increase in existing non-conformities.  Premises are designated as Section 21, Block 41, Lot 71 on the Nassau County Land and Tax Map.
